Software fault injection

WebDec 20, 2024 · Software fault injection (SFI) is an acknowledged method for assessing the dependability of software systems. After reviewing the state-of-the-art of SFI, we address … WebI am Associate Professor at the Federico II University of Naples, Italy, and co-founder of Secureware s.r.l. (a joint venture with DigitalPlatforms S.p.A.) and Critiware s.r.l. (formerly an academic spin-off company). My research interests are in software security and dependability. The main recurring theme of my research activity is the experimental …

Noble George – System Test Manager – ZF Group LinkedIn

WebAWS Fault Injection Simulator (FIS) is a fully managed service for running fault injection experiments to improve an application’s performance, observability, and resiliency. FIS simplifies the process of setting up and running controlled fault injection experiments across a range of AWS services, so teams can build confidence in their application … WebHowever, fault injection differs as it requires a specific approach to test a single condition. Fault injection testing can also be applied to hardware, as it will simulate hardware … sichuan university application fee https://construct-ability.net

What is fault injection - LinkedIn

WebIf the scope of the fault injection capability is limited to a single kernel module, it is better to provide module parameters to configure the fault attributes. add a hook to insert failures. … Webthat instruments a hardware design with fault injection capabilities. This work-in-progress framework, Chire , automates the instru-mentation of a hardware design with run-time congurable fault ... others have adopted software approaches gleaned from compilers, e.g., writing transforms that modify a hardware Intermediate Representation (IR) [10]. WebThe goal is twofold: accurately model RTL faults at the software level and materialize software fault models to actual RTL injections. These goals lead to a better understanding of a system's security against hardware fault injection, which is important to design effective and cost-efficient countermeasures. the persuasive management style

Fault Injection in Software Engineering - GeeksforGeeks

Category:Intentional and Accidental Fault Injection in Virtual Platforms

Tags:Software fault injection

Software fault injection

ASFIT: AUTOSAR-Based Software Fault Injection Test for Vehicles

WebFault Injection and Robustness Testing. Voas, Jeffrey M., and Keith W. Miller. ... "Emulation of software faults by educated mutations at machine-code level." ISSRE 2002 . Software Aging and Rejuvenation. Garg, S., Puliafito, A ... WebAt eShard, we propose a ready to use glitching hardware setup that has been designed to fault complex designs such as FPGAs. The hardware bench includes: A high end oscilloscope that is sufficient for fault injection. A waveform generator selected for successful glitching The hardware comes integrated with eShard’s Fault Injection …

Software fault injection

Did you know?

WebThe Fault Injection technique is very useful in that it allows to evaluate the behavior of computing systems in the presence of faults. Among the various methods to perform fault injection, Software Implemented Fault Injection is getting more popular, where faults are injected at the software level by corrupting code or data. WebTo demonstrate the proposed fault injection method, we extendedtheC-Patrolassertioninsertionsystem[18] tosup-port fault injection and built a visual X Window …

Webcontext of fault injection methods used over the last few years. KEYWORDS: Fault injection; SWFI; software fault; fault tolerance; fault injection tools, fault injection techniques. I. … WebApr 8, 2015 · Fault injection is a commonly used technique to test the tolerance of a software system methodically. All the real time systems tend to have faults which leaks …

WebNov 4, 2024 · Software Fault Injection is a well known technique used for evaluating dependability of systems in presence of faults. Traditionally aiming at reproducing the … WebThe invention provides a software fault injection and analysis process definition method, which comprises the following steps of step 1, carrying out earlier stage processing …

WebJul 8, 2024 · Authors: Jeremy Boone, Sultan Qasim Khan This blog post is a continuation of part 1, which introduced the concept of fault injection attacks. You can read that prior …

WebTo demonstrate the proposed fault injection method, we extendedtheC-Patrolassertioninsertionsystem[18] tosup-port fault injection and built a visual X Window System in-terface. 3.1. C-Patrol C-Patrolisa codeinsertiontoolthatcanassist developers in the placement of software probes that are used in testing. the pert chart stands forWebFCM such as Fault injection testing, software interface testing etc. Checking the performances after injecting the faults indicates Fault injection testing. Whereas interface testing checks the integration of different functional units in the software. My responsibilities include Requirement Analysis, Test-case Development and Test the pert chartWebApr 7, 2024 · Another brutal attack in San Francisco shocked residents this week after several other instances of random violence. Former San Francisco Fire Commissioner Don Carmignani was leaving his mother's home in the Marina District at about 7 p.m. on Wednesday when three homeless men approached him. Joe Alioto Veronese, a prominent … sichuan university introductionWeb•Experience working as a locomotive mechanic in training at Ontario Southland Railway. Gained knowledge barring engine over to ensure proper fuel injection timing as well as detecting faulty injectors/replacing of injectors for V12s and V16s, valve clearances etc. Inspection and maintenance of locomotive main generator, aux generator, traction … the pert formulaWebFeb 11, 2010 · There is a codeplex project called TestAPI that can do runtime fault injection. You need to look at its managed code fault injection API. It uses the CLR profiling API to … the pert groupWebWith the rise of software complexity, software-related accidents represent a significant threat for computer-based systems. Software Fault Injection is a method to anticipate … sichuan university global rankingWebAug 10, 2024 · Fault injection simulation with Rainbow. Fault injection effects are usually simulated as corruptions during register write (bit stuck-at model) or as instructions skips … sichuan university online application portal